The EnergyTime Spike Devils Campobasso team is gradually taking shape in view of what will be the second consecutive season of the rossoblù in the Serie A3 Credem Banca.

The ninth piece of the mosaic, who will be integrated on the front of the central department, is the nineteen-year-old Umbrian Diego Bartolini, a third-placed Spoleto player who grew up in the Perugia youth system and last season in Acicastello in A2.

A 198-centimeter player, Bartolini speaks of himself as “a physical central” who has as his favorite fundamental “that of the wall”.

“I arrive in Campobasso really enthusiastic about this opportunity – he recognizes – and I am ready to bring all my determination to give my all for the cause. Knowing that I have a coach like Bua who, in his volleyball career was a middle blocker, gave me even more strength in my decision also because many of my former teammates in the last season who had him as a trainer in Catania spoke well of him and all this feedback represented a factor that influenced and gave strength at the same time to my choice».

Another incentive, moreover, is that linked to the rossoblù faithful public. «Knowing that you have so many fans close to the cause and ready to support you in every match, especially those at home, is a significant factor and will certainly have its weight in our path, because the support gives you determination, personally and as a team».
